Output c888a55aca0cb6491dc8a137920bfdb7f08043d7b346d09f9bdfa2ca8eadffa4:1

value
21084260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f999b3455959baabb457fb388097109b1eaf9eb OP_EQUAL
address
3DKhkf3eTAns45U88B4wpZ9cgszZbR4UDw
transaction
c888a55aca0cb6491dc8a137920bfdb7f08043d7b346d09f9bdfa2ca8eadffa4
confirmations
456806
spent
true